Key Facts
- Georgia state income tax on $365,000 is $20,075 — 5.50% of gross income.
- Combined with federal taxes and FICA, total tax burden is $129,818 (35.57%).
- Take-home pay is $235,182, or $19,599 per month.
- See your county or city for any local income taxes that may apply.
$365,000 Income Tax Breakdown in Georgia
| Tax | Amount | Eff. Rate |
|---|---|---|
| Federal Income Tax | $92,047 | 25.22% |
| Georgia State Income Tax | $20,075 | 5.50% |
| Social Security (6.2%) | $10,918 | 2.99% |
| Medicare (1.45%+) | $6,778 | 1.86% |
| Total Tax | $129,818 | 35.57% |
| Take-Home Pay | $235,182 | 64.43% |
